Leading Choices for Streamlined Tracking

For users seeking the ultimate in simplicity, the Samsung Galaxy Ring stands out for its “set-it-and-forget-it” integration. It skips the complexity of subscription models, providing a straightforward “Energy Score” that summarizes your daily readiness in a single, clear number.

Another strong contender for minimalist fans is the RingConn Gen 2 Air, which prioritizes extreme battery longevity and a lightweight profile. With up to 12 days of power on a single charge, it removes the daily chore of plugging in your device, making it a truly passive companion.

For those who want a beginner-friendly entry point, the Amazfit Helio offers an uncomplicated app experience that focuses on the core pillars of sleep and recovery. It provides accurate tracking without the “data-heavy” approach that can sometimes be overwhelming for new users.

Prioritizing Effortless Daily Maintenance

A simple fitness ring is defined by how little effort it requires to maintain, ensuring that it never becomes a burden on your schedule. This includes features like automatic activity detection, which recognizes when you are walking or sleeping without any manual input.

Extended battery life is a critical component of this simplicity, as it allows you to wear the device for a full week or more without interruption. This ensures that there are no gaps in your health data, providing a continuous and reliable picture of your long-term wellness trends.

Charging cases that double as portable power banks further enhance this convenience, allowing you to top up your ring while on the move. This level of physical simplicity ensures that the technology fits into your life as easily as a traditional piece of jewelry.

A Focus on Actionable, Human-Centric Data

Simplified fitness rings prioritize “Actionable Insights” over raw numbers, presenting your data in a way that is easy to understand and apply. Instead of showing you complex graphs of heart rate variability, the app might simply suggest that you prioritize an early bedtime.

This human-centric approach turns your biological signals into helpful advice that supports your daily goals. It helps you build healthy habits through gentle encouragement rather than technical pressure, making the path to wellness feel more intuitive and achievable.

By distilling your biometrics into a few key scores—such as Readiness or Stress—the ring provides a high-level view of your current state. This clarity allows you to make quick, informed decisions about your day without needing to be an expert in data analysis.
